Good day

Recently switched to O2. My home has always had poor mobile signal and I've always relied on WiFi calling with my previous provider. 

I do not have the option to turn on WiFi calling on my phone since having an O2 sim card. 
I have an Iphone 13 Pro with IOS 18.
I cannot find any options within my O2 account to enable WiFi calling (as some forums suggested). 

 

Is my phone unsupported in terms of firmware required? Or is this something I need to ask O2 to enable on my account?

@AL22 If you are Pay & Go Wi-Fi calling is not available. 

If you are a Pay Monthly customer see this:

Well definitely no WiFi Calling on PAYG.

Also no VoLTE (4G Calling) and 5G.

Quite frankly I would not use O2 PAYG until they make a decision on these things as with 3G shutdown you may find you are using 2G for calls
